“People” is used to refer to multiple persons: There are several people standing over there. Some people (persons) like coffee; other people (persons) like tea. In that meaning, “people” is itself plural: “people like tea, not “people likes tea.”
“Peoples” is the plural of a DIFFERENT meaning of “people,” in which “people” means “an ethnic group” or “a nation” or “the group of people living in some particular place, or having some particular characteristics.” The Sioux are a people. The French are a people. The Hmong are a people. THIS is the meaning used in “the people of the world.”
